Again, thanks! | | | | Joined: Dec 2001 Posts: 14,522 Moderator: Welcome Centre, Southern Bolters, Legion Hall | | Moderator: Welcome Centre, Southern Bolters, Legion Hall Joined: Dec 2001 Posts: 14,522 | If the carb flooded a lot the excess gas could have washed all the oil off the cylinder walls and it siezed up. Take the plugs out and if nothing seem wrong I would put some Marvel Mystery oil in the cylinders and let it set of a couple days. Right now its better to take a little time than cause even more problems. Keep us posted. | | |
